    My partners application for partnership work visa was approved and were very happy about it.The question i have is that it was approved for 6 months and not a year.What would be the best thing to do when the 6 months run out in feb as we would be a couple of months short of the 12 months living together to apply for partnership residency

    Keep on collecting evidence, and keep the original evidence safe, because she will need to apply for another partner-sponsored temporary work visa before this one runs out. ALWAYS keep collecting evidence, right up till the time when she is granted residence, because INZ commonly ask for more to cover the time of processing, just before a visa is issued.

    Thankyou JandM.We defintly will be collecting evidence of everything.If the visa runs out in feb when would be a good time to apply for another one?Allso scince she has been granted one and if nothing changes between now and feb will we have a better chance of being granted another one

    She can apply any time right up till just before the other visa expires, as INZ can issue an Interim visa to keep her legal if the processing needs to continue beyond expiry of the previous visa, and as she'll be applying for the same kind of visa she already has, the terms will be the same (she'll still be able to work). https://www.immigration.govt.nz/new-...isa-conditions

    To answer your last question, yes, you should have a good chance of its going through easily, but you still have to PROVE that nothing has changed and you are still living together, hence the need for keeping up the evidence collecting.
